| /** |
| * Represents ONOS YANG tool manager. |
| */ |
| public class YangToolManager { |
| |
| private static final Logger log = getLogger(YangToolManager.class); |
| public static final String DEFAULT_JAR_RES_PATH = SLASH + TEMP + SLASH + |
| YANG_RESOURCES + SLASH; |
| public static final String YANG_META_DATA = "YangMetaData"; |
| public static final String SERIALIZED_FILE_EXTENSION = ".ser"; |
| |
| // YANG file information set. |
| private Set<YangFileInfo> yangFileInfoSet; //initialize in tool invocation; |
| private final YangUtilsParser yangUtilsParser = new YangUtilsParserManager(); |
| private final YangLinker yangLinker = new YangLinkerManager(); |
| private YangFileInfo curYangFileInfo = new YangFileInfo(); |
| private final Set<YangNode> yangNodeSet = new HashSet<>(); |
| |
| /** |
| * Provides a list of files from list of strings. |
| * |
| * @param yangFileInfo set of yang file information |
| * @return list of files |
| */ |
| private static List<File> getListOfFile(Set<YangFileInfo> yangFileInfo) { |
| List<File> files = new ArrayList<>(); |
| Iterator<YangFileInfo> yangFileIterator = yangFileInfo.iterator(); |
| while (yangFileIterator.hasNext()) { |
| YangFileInfo yangFile = yangFileIterator.next(); |
| if (yangFile.isForTranslator()) { |
| files.add(new File(yangFile.getYangFileName())); |
| } |
| } |
| return files; |
| } |
| |
| /** |
| * Compile te YANG files and generate the corresponding Java files. |
| * Update the generated bundle with the schema metadata. |
| * |
| * @param yangFiles Application YANG files |
| * @param config tool configuration |
| * @param plugin invoking plugin |
| */ |
| public void compileYangFiles(Set<YangFileInfo> yangFiles, |
| List<YangNode> dependentSchema, |
| YangPluginConfig config, |
| CallablePlugin plugin) throws IOException { |
| |
| try { |
| |
| if (config == null || yangFiles == null) { |
| throw new YangToolException(E_MISSING_INPUT); |
| } |
| yangFileInfoSet = yangFiles; |
| |
| if (config.getCodeGenDir() == null) { |
| throw new YangToolException(E_CODE_GEN_PATH); |
| } |
| |
| // Check if there are any file to translate, if not return. |
| if (yangFileInfoSet == null || yangFileInfoSet.isEmpty()) { |
| // No files to translate |
| return; |
| } |
| |
| createDirectories(config.resourceGenDir()); |
| |
| // Resolve inter jar dependency. |
| addSchemaToFileSet(dependentSchema); |
| |
| |
| // Carry out the parsing for all the YANG files. |
| parseYangFileInfoSet(); |
| |
| // Resolve dependencies using linker. |
| resolveDependenciesUsingLinker(); |
| |
| // Perform translation to JAVA. |
| translateToJava(config); |
| |
| // Serialize data model. |
| Set<YangNode> compiledSchemas = new HashSet<>(); |
| for (YangFileInfo fileInfo : yangFileInfoSet) { |
| compiledSchemas.add(fileInfo.getRootNode()); |
| } |
| |
| String serFileName = config.resourceGenDir() + YANG_META_DATA + SERIALIZED_FILE_EXTENSION; |
| FileOutputStream fileOutputStream = new FileOutputStream(serFileName); |
| ObjectOutputStream objectOutputStream = new ObjectOutputStream(fileOutputStream); |
| objectOutputStream.writeObject(compiledSchemas); |
| objectOutputStream.close(); |
| fileOutputStream.close(); |
| |
| |
| //add YANG files to JAR |
| List<File> files = getListOfFile(yangFileInfoSet); |
| String path = config.resourceGenDir(); |
| File targetDir = new File(path); |
| targetDir.mkdirs(); |
| |
| for (File file : files) { |
| Files.copy(file.toPath(), |
| new File(path + file.getName()).toPath(), |
| StandardCopyOption.REPLACE_EXISTING); |
| } |
| |
| if (plugin != null) { |
| plugin.addCompiledSchemaToBundle(); |
| plugin.addGeneratedCodeToBundle(); |
| plugin.addYangFilesToBundle(); |
| } |
| |
| } catch (IOException | ParserException e) { |
| YangToolException exception = |
| new YangToolException(e.getMessage(), e); |
| exception.setCurYangFile(curYangFileInfo); |
| |
| if (curYangFileInfo != null && |
| curYangFileInfo.getRootNode() != null) { |
| try { |
| translatorErrorHandler(curYangFileInfo.getRootNode(), |
| config); |
| } catch (IOException ex) { |
| e.printStackTrace(); |
| throw ex; |
| } |
| } |
| |
| throw exception; |
| } |
| } |
